Who are the real Sandra and Beth?
Sandra and Beth were 16 and 15 years old, respectively, when they drowned their alcoholic mom in their Mississauga townhouse bathtub on Jan. 18, 2003. They drugged her with Tylenol 3s and staged the crime to look like accidental death — and it worked, at first.
What is the Perfect Sisters name?
In 2008, journalist Bob Mitchell wrote the book The Class Project: How to Kill a Mother – The True Story of Canada’s Infamous Bathtub Girls. In 2014, the crime drama film Perfect Sisters, based on the murder of Linda Andersen, went into limited release.
Where is Perfect Sisters filmed?
Filmed in Winnipeg, the movie stars Abigail Breslin, known for “Little Miss Sunshine” and Georgie Henley, known for “The Chronicles of Narnia” series. It’s based on the book by former Toronto Star reporter Bob Mitchell, “The Class Project: How to Kill a Mother: The True Story of Canada’s Infamous Bathtub Girls.”

Was Perfect Sisters a true story?
Short answer: Yes. While the story about the Canadian sisters’ successful plot to murder their alcoholic mother in a bathtub is true, there are pieces of the story that have been changed that critics say make the girls look more sympathetic than the convicted killers they really are in real life.
Where are the bath tub sisters now?
Both of them are now free and still safely anonymous, having served only a fraction of the 10 years’ incarceration they were sentenced to. They’ve both been studying at university and the younger sister — wait for it — aspires to a career in law.
